Robot vacuums have been around for quite some time so the choice is growing rapidly as well. One of the most important points to consider in the appliance is the mapping. The way robot vacuums navigate on your flooring is necessary to determine their efficacy in cleaning. The cheaper options such as Coredy R500+ Vs Eufy 11S will move randomly but the more sophisticated choice like Roborock S7 will have a sensor to digitally map the house.
The digital map lets the vacuum move more effectively because it has a certain pattern to follow and can detect the shape of the room to design a more effective cleaning process. The other advantage is we can command the vacuum from the app to clean a certain room only or in some models limit the cleaning space they can access by drawing borders on the app.
Another capability that is important in a robot vacuum is to be scheduled. This is available in most robot vacuums in the market, even on the entry-level. The method is what sets them apart because the lower models are usually adjusted through the remote control while the more advanced vacuums are using the app. Scheduling is one of the best parts of a robot vacuum because we can command the appliance to work at certain times only.
For example when you are not in the home so we don’t have to hear the noise coming out of the appliance as we sleep or just enjoy the rest of the day. In the high-end choices, the scheduling can be combined with digital mapping to let the vacuum do their work at different sections of rooms in the house at different times.
In addition, make sure your vacuum has a certain way to limit the operational area with physical boundaries or digital mapping. This feature is important because sometimes we don’t want them to enter a certain part of the house as there are lots of small items scattered on the floor or it may be your pet or kids room to prevent it from getting tangled or stuck on their toys.

Xiaomi Mop Pro and Roborock S6 Design
Both vacuums are very similar and if you see them closely, the only thing that separates the two is just how they put the control layout at the top surface of the unit. There is a sensor at the top which adds height into the vacuum and in comparison to many other entry-level vacuums without the top sensor, they will be taller as well or above 3 inches. The button layout is very simple with only the power button and a home button on Xiaomi or with an edge cleaning button on Roborock.
When you flip the unit, we can see the same layout as well on the cleaning tools. There is one rotating brush at the front combined with a rolling brush near the vacuum opening. With the purchase you will get their water canister as well along with the moping fabric; the Xiaomi bin is a 2-in-1 so there is only one. The dustbin inside is accessible when you open the top panel of the vacuum. The capacity for dry dirt is 300 ml and 480 ml while for liquid it is 200 ml and 140 ml respectively.
Xiaomi Mop Pro and Roborock S6 Vacuum Performance
Now for the most important part, let’s see what Xiaomi Mop Pro and Roborock S6 can offer starting from the suction performance. We are unsure about the official rating of Mop Pro, in this comparison the STYJ02YM while the S6 is claimed at 2000 pa, the same as S5 Max. In the real life performance both are impressive, we honestly don’t see a difference or at least meaningful one that is noticeable with naked eyes as they are both very reliable.
What’s different is when you move to carpet because here Mop Pro is not as effective at cleaning fine debris including hair unlike the S6 which is still reliable. At first we are worried about how the rotating brush seems to push some dirt slightly further but since the vacuum will move on the spot or for several times, it is not an issue at all in the end. The noise is also not a concern but in low power mode the Mop Pro is quieter while in higher cleaning modes the S6 is actually quieter than Mop Pro.
Xiaomi Mop Pro and Roborock S6 Mop Performance
Next let’s talk about the mopping function that you can utilize to finish the cleaning or conveniently dealing with some dried wine or coffee spill on the flooring. In practice both Xiaomi Mop Pro and Roborock S6 are very reliable but we do think the S6 doesn’t dispense enough water at the beginning. Don’t worry as it is adjustable manually with a switch located at the mopping part of the vacuum. Performance wise Mop Pro is more effective.
We are unsure whether it is because the vacuum puts more pressure on the surface or because it dispenses more water but the result is it can clean the mess more effectively compared to S6, especially if the stain is far from an obstacle or a wall for example.

Xiaomi Mop Pro vs Roborock S6
Both vacuums are great especially for hard flooring but on carpet we do think the S6 is working much better including for fibers like hairs. The S6 has less reliable mopping performance however because when Mop Pro detects dirt, it sticks on the spot to clean it rather than just pass the wider area several times. The no go zone feature or mapping are reliable for the two vacuums as they can avoid it perfectly so there is no need for a physical barrier.
Conclusion
You can go amazing with any of these vacuums but the strengths are on different parts. We do recommend Roborock S6 because it is affordable and has a better overall cleaning ability on both hard floor and carpet while Mop Pro is great for hard flooring and mopping.
